From: Alyssa Rosenzweig Date: Fri, 14 Aug 2020 19:50:13 +0000 (-0400) Subject: panfrost: Use packs for varying buffers X-Git-Url: https://git.libre-soc.org/?p=mesa.git;a=commitdiff_plain;h=ec58cda5da0b7d43b5ff71db4f4f3b85629e6739 panfrost: Use packs for varying buffers In addition to better aesthetics, this automatically fixed multiple instances of accidental CPU readback of GPU buffers -- in a hot path, too!
